Meet Reggie, a Miniature Poodle who was dumped on the streets to fend for himself. He was so scared to approach people that we had to trap him. His coat was so mangled and covered with cling ons that we had to shave him down completely and there was a beautiful dog under there! (before pics available on request) He's a sweet little boy but gets very nervous when strangers come in the house. He is best to be with an older couple and no small children in the house. He's very snuggly and lovable, just doesn't like a lot of commotion. Our vet estimated him to be around 4 -5 years. We had his teeth cleaned and polished as he had the beginning of tartar build up, more than likely due to a poor diet. He is neutered, heart worm negative, vaccinated, crate trained and microchipped. Reggie is more than ready for his forever home, could that be you?
